A Watershed Moment
News of the defective cups came to a head in Spring 2008, when orthopedic researcher and surgeon, Dr. Larry Dorr, delivered a speech to the American Association of Hip and Knee Surgeons. A “very high rate” of his patients who underwent implantation procedures for Zimmer hip replacement products complained of severe pelvic pain, and later had to undergo strenuous corrective surgery.
Dr. Dorr stated that the primary reason for the product’s failure was poor construction. “We do not believe the fixation surface is good on these cups,” he said. “When we hit on the edge of the cups, they would pop out of the hip socket. Also, there is a circular cutting surface on the periphery of the cup that we believe prevents the cup from fully seating.”
Instead of accepting responsibility for the pain, Zimmer Holdings Inc. blamed the widespread failure of their product on surgical negligence. Yet when Zimmer was informed of the implants’ defects in 2007 (a year after the cups debuted), an entire year passed before the company conducted any investigations.

The Problem with Zimmer Durom Cup Implants
Zimmer Holdings Inc. designed the Zimmer Durom Hip Replacement cup for people suffering from non-inflammatory degenerative joint disease. The cobalt-chromium cups, which were meant to bond securely to the patient’s hip socket, often slipped out of place, resulting in excruciating pain. Following a series of complaints and complications, production of the cups was officially discontinued by order of the U.S. Food & Drug Administration (FDA) in July 2008. In some cases, patients suffered for months and even years after their implant surgeries. In the hopes of alleviating the discomfort, the patients, many of whom were elderly, had to endure the stress and costs of additional surgery.
